ScriptAlias error in apache log

Bob livingsky at gmail.com
Wed Aug 3 14:59:38 UTC 2016


I just had reason to restart my apache webserver and noticed these 
errors in the log (I was checking the log due to another issue).

**/var/log/syslog
Jul 27 16:38:30 server apache2[30214]: [Wed Jul 27 16:38:30.563281 2016] 
[alias:warn] [pid 30232] AH00671: The ScriptAlias directive in 
/etc/apache2/sites-enabled/mailman.conf at line 4 will probably never 
match because it overlaps an earlier ScriptAlias.
Jul 27 16:38:30 server apache2[30214]: AH00558: apache2: Could not 
reliably determine the server's fully qualified domain name, using 
127.0.1.1. Set the 'ServerName' directive globally to suppress this message

There are two errors that I see. The first one is a ScriptAlias error 
and when I check 'etc/apache2/sites-enabled/mailman.conf', line 4, this 
is what it says 'ScriptAlias /cgi-bin/mailman/ /usr/lib/cgi-bin/mailman/'

I looked for another ScriptAlias that might be in conflict but am not 
sure about which ones are having troubles

**bob at server:/etc/apache2$ grep -sir "ScriptAlias"*
mods-available/mime.conf:    # To use CGI scripts outside of 
ScriptAliased directories:
sites-available/mailman.conf:ScriptAlias /cgi-bin/mailman/ 
/usr/lib/cgi-bin/mailman/
sites-available/mailman.conf:#ScriptAlias /mailman/ 
/usr/lib/cgi-bin/mailman/
sites-available/mailman.conf:#ScriptAlias /admin 
/usr/lib/cgi-bin/mailman/admin
sites-available/mailman.conf:#ScriptAlias /admindb 
/usr/lib/cgi-bin/mailman/admindb
sites-available/mailman.conf:#ScriptAlias /confirm 
/usr/lib/cgi-bin/mailman/confirm
sites-available/mailman.conf:#ScriptAlias /create 
/usr/lib/cgi-bin/mailman/create
sites-available/mailman.conf:#ScriptAlias /edithtml 
/usr/lib/cgi-bin/mailman/edithtml
sites-available/mailman.conf:#ScriptAlias /listinfo 
/usr/lib/cgi-bin/mailman/listinfo
sites-available/mailman.conf:#ScriptAlias /options 
/usr/lib/cgi-bin/mailman/options
sites-available/mailman.conf:#ScriptAlias /private 
/usr/lib/cgi-bin/mailman/private
sites-available/mailman.conf:#ScriptAlias /rmlist 
/usr/lib/cgi-bin/mailman/rmlist
sites-available/mailman.conf:#ScriptAlias /roster 
/usr/lib/cgi-bin/mailman/roster
sites-available/mailman.conf:#ScriptAlias /subscribe 
/usr/lib/cgi-bin/mailman/subscribe
sites-available/mailman.conf:#ScriptAlias /mailman/ 
/usr/lib/cgi-bin/mailman/
conf-available/serve-cgi-bin.conf:        ScriptAlias /cgi-bin/ 
/usr/lib/cgi-bin/

The second problem seemingly is the ServerName.

**/etc/hosts
127.0.0.1       localhost
127.0.1.1       server server.faithwalk.ca faithwalk.ca
#24.72.66.135   faithwalk.ca server.faithwalk.ca server

# The following lines are desirable for IPv6 capable hosts
::1     ip6-localhost ip6-loopback
fe00::0 ip6-localnet
ff00::0 ip6-mcastprefix
ff02::1 ip6-allnodes
ff02::2 ip6-allrouters

and

**/etc/resolv.conf
# Dynamic resolv.conf(5) file for glibc resolver(3) generated by 
resolvconf(8)
#     DO NOT EDIT THIS FILE BY HAND -- YOUR CHANGES WILL BE OVERWRITTEN
nameserver 127.0.1.1
search accesscomm.ca

I do not know how to change whatever it is I need to change to my 
resolv.conf so it reflects my actual nameserver or change the "serve 
accesscomm.ca" to the google servers.





More information about the ubuntu-users mailing list